Capable Leaders Can Still Second-Guess Themselves

Many senior leaders do not struggle because they lack ability. They struggle because the expectations are bigger, the rooms are more senior, and the margin for unclear communication feels smaller.

You may over-prepare before meetings, hold back when you should speak, over-explain to prove your point, avoid difficult conversations, or replay decisions long after they are made.

These moments can quietly affect how you lead, how others experience your authority, and how confidently you move into bigger responsibilities.

CareerCapital helps you understand where self-doubt shows up and build a more grounded way to lead through it.

Leadership confidence is not about never feeling pressure. It is about leading with clarity, steadiness, and self-trust when the pressure is real.

FAQs

What is leadership confidence?

Leadership confidence is the ability to lead with clarity, steadiness, and self-trust when pressure, visibility, or uncertainty are high. It is not about always feeling certain. It is about trusting your judgment and communicating with credibility when it matters.

Leadership confidence is the internal steadiness and self-trust you bring to your role. Executive presence is how that confidence is experienced by others through your communication, composure, credibility, and influence.

Decision-making confidence improves when you clarify priorities, evaluate trade-offs, communicate your reasoning, and learn to move forward without over-explaining or second-guessing every decision.
